WebWestern Mountain Ash, Greene's mountain ash, Cascade mountain ash: Family: Rosaceae: USDA hardiness: 4-8: Known Hazards: The seeds probably contain hydrogen cyanide. This is the ingredient that gives almonds their characteristic flavour. Unless the seed is very bitter it should be perfectly safe in reasonable quantities.
